
Multiclass Pick 'n' Mix Multiclassing in Dungeons and Dragons is a fun way to add some extra flavour to a character concept. The fighter who dabbles in destructive magic. The barbarian who makes a deal with a devil. The bard who devotes themselves to the Goddess of Luck. Unfortunately, multiclassing, as an optional rule, isn't completely balanced. The synergies between some classes are far stronger than others.
